From WordNet (r) 2.0 [wn]:

finely

adverb

1: in tiny pieces; "the surfaces were finely granular" [ant: {coarsely}]

2: in an elegant manner; "finely costumed actors"

3: in a superior and skilled manner; "the soldiers were fighting finely" [syn: {fine}]

4: in a delicate manner; "finely shaped features"; "her fine drawn body" [syn: {fine}, {delicately}, {exquisitely}]
